Chuleta Valluna

Chuleta valluna is a typical dish from the Valle del Cauca region of Colombia. It is prepared with breaded pork loin, and is similar to veal Milanese or Viennese schnitzel.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 3 lb pork loin
  • 3 cloves garlic , chopped
  • 2 scallions , finely chopped
  • 1 white onion , finely chopped
  • ½ teaspoon cumin ground
  • cup flour
  • 1 tablespoon Sazon Goya seasoning with saffron or achiote
  • 4 egg
  • 2 cups bread crumbs
  • ½ cup vegetable oil
  • salt
  • black pepper

Equipment

  • meat mallet

Instructions

  1. Cut the pork loin into 6 slices and place them between two sheets of parchment paper.
  2. Pound the slices with a mallet until each piece is very thin.
  3. Place in a large plastic bag and add the scallion, onion, garlic and cumin.
  4. Seal the bag and make sure the meat is fully covered.
  5. Marinate the pork for 4 hours or overnight.
  6. In a deep dish, add the flour and Sazon Goya and mix.
  7. In a second deep dish, beat the eggs.
  8. In a third deep dish, pour the breadcrumbs.
  9. Heat the oil in a large pan at medium heat.
  10. Remove the pork from the marinade and dry with paper towels.
  11. Dredge each slice of pork in the flour mixture and Sazon Goya.
  12. Then dip each of them in the beaten eggs and then cover them generously with breadcrumbs.
  13. Add the pork slices in hot oil and fry for about 3 minutes on each side.
  14. If the temperature is too hot, lower the heat a little. The pork should be golden brown and fully cooked inside.
  15. Drain on paper towels and serve immediately.
